Meter Parking to Use e-Money in November

Jakarta Transportation Department will change the payment system of meter parking on Jalan Agus Salim (Sabang), Central Jakarta, in upcoming November. Later, the use of coins will be replaced with electronic money.

Head of Jakarta Parking Management Unit (UP), Sunardi Sinaga, uttered that to realize the use of electronic money in meter parking, his party cooperates with six banks. These banks are also banks that are cooperated in the use of TransJakarta bus electronic ticket.

“Those six banks are BCA flazz, BNI tapcash, BRI brizzi, Mandiri Bank e-money, Mega Bank megacard, and DKI Bank jakcard,” he stated, Tuesday (10/28).

According to Sinaga, the electronic money used it meter parking payment can also be used to pay TransJakarta bus tariff. For the beginning, some shops selling e-money cards will be built on Jalan Sabang. These shops will facilitate car owners who have not had e-money.

“There will be many shops selling e-money cards provided on Jalan Sabang to facilitate the citizens,” he said.
